Transaction 6908ab2658236bad0c813ef08ab329d83e5e80f96ba7518628151390e7e7c65c
1 Input
1 Output
-
6908ab2658236bad0c813ef08ab329d83e5e80f96ba7518628151390e7e7c65c:0
- value
- 100240
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 844d42b8e0d68da272378d2a1ae8eb9819b7c7d34737de7bf904e6d6c03eb8ce
- address
- bc1ps3x59w8q66x6yu3h354p468tnqvm037ngumau7leqnnddsp7hr8qs6k05r